‘Migrating Metals’ is a collaborative project between Storiel, Gwynedd Archaeological Trust, Oriel Môn and Conwy Museums Service. Examining the themes of trade and migration, the display will exhibit artefacts received through the Saving Treasures project as well as other metal artefacts in Storiel’s collection from the Bronze Age up to the Medieval period.

Storiel’s museum collection has many examples of ‘recycling’. Some are beautiful pieces made from treasured fragments, others discarded broken objects used in a new way. Exhibits from our reserve collection.
